I started out on a Small M3, and at just on 5'7" found it slightly undersized when upright and pedaling.
On full on DH and coasting, the size felt spot on.

On my next rig I went with a Medium M6 and it feels great on the open but if anything its a smidgen too big on the tight techy stuff.

I've just ordered a medium 951 and I've come to realize the top tube is 0.5" bigger over the M6.
Now the seat tube on the 951 is smaller than the M6 by 0.75", so would that have a bearing on the effective top tube length?

I'm not sure if I should change the order to a small..
(I've uploaded the Socom, M6, 951 Stats)

Wheelbase and chainstay for the m6 and the 951 are the same and they have basically the same HA, so your front centre distance is going to be the same.

The m6's seat tube angle is very slack with a shorter tt to get the same placement as the 951.

Honestly don't think it will matter to you if the tt is a bit different, just get an I-beam post, that'll give you a good 2" of tt length adjustment.
